The Fenton housing market has its own unique rhythm. Property values can vary significantly between the more established neighborhoods and the expansive rural parcels that define much of Jefferson Davis Parish. A local FHA loan officer doesn't just process paperwork; they understand this landscape. They can advise you on what types of properties in the area are likely to meet FHA's strict appraisal and minimum property standards, which is crucial for older homes or fixer-uppers that might be common in the region. Their on-the-ground knowledge helps set realistic expectations from the start, preventing you from falling in love with a home that might not pass a stringent FHA appraisal.
When looking for your local officer, don't just search online. Ask for referrals from Fenton-area real estate agents who regularly work with first-time buyers. These professionals have a vested interest in your success and know which lenders and loan officers navigate the local process smoothly. Once you have a few names, ask specific questions: "How many FHA loans have you closed in Jefferson Davis Parish in the last year?" and "Can you walk me through a recent challenge you solved with a local FHA appraisal?" Their answers will tell you if they have the experience you need.
Louisiana also offers fantastic state-level programs that can be layered with an FHA loan, and a knowledgeable local officer will be your guide. The Louisiana Mortgage Revenue Bond Program offers competitive interest rates and down payment assistance to eligible first-time homebuyers. Combining this with an FHA loan's 3.5% down payment can dramatically reduce your upfront costs, a huge advantage when saving for a home in Fenton. Your loan officer should be well-versed in these programs and know how to seamlessly integrate them with your FHA application.
